I’m Mujibur Rahman, a British Bangladeshi writer exploring life between the UK and Bangladesh through short stories, cultural reflections, and clear, grounded writing about history and current affairs.

This site is where I publish work that sits at the crossroads of identity, community, memory, and modern reality. Sometimes that looks like fiction set in British Bangladeshi neighbourhoods. Sometimes it looks like research-led writing that makes sense of Bangladesh’s past and present. Either way, the goal is the same: to tell the truth as carefully as I can, and to tell stories that feel real.

Why I Write

I’ve spent years balancing responsibilities with the urge to create something lasting. Writing became the one thing I could return to no matter how busy life got. It’s how I process what I see around me, how I preserve what matters, and how I give shape to the experiences that often go undocumented.

My long-term plan is to write more consistently and produce bigger work that reflects the depth of our communities and the complexity of our histories without reducing them to headlines.
